CENTRAL FALLS, R.I.

Teachers union chief won’t attend summit

Associated Press / January 18, 2011

The head of the Central Falls teachers union is skipping a national conference intended to improve relations between teachers and schools because she says the district is not willing to establish real collaboration. Union president Jane Sessums said attending the conference would be insincere. Superintendent Frances Gallo said she is disappointed with Sessums’ decision because she said she is trying to move contract negotiation from adversarial to being a conversation about how to best serve students. Central Falls High School made national headlines last year when it fired, then rehired, its entire teaching staff.
